captilze(): 首字母大寫swapcase():大小寫反轉
upper() : 全部大寫
lower(): 全部小寫
find:通過元素找索引,找到第乙個就返回,可以切片,找不到返回-1.
index:通過元素找索引,找到第乙個就返回,可以切片,找不到報錯.
replace(old,new,count): 替換。
center: 居中
count:計算某個元素出現的次數。
split:
str ---> list
分割,預設按照空格進行分割,可以指定字元。
可以設定分割次數。
rsplit。
strip:預設去除字串兩邊的空格,製表符,換行符。
可以指定字元。
lstrip rstrip
format:格式化輸出。
isdigit():判斷字串是否全部由數字組成。
isalpha():判斷字串是否全部由字母組成。
isalnum(): 判斷字串是否全部由字母或者數字組成。
startswith,endswith:
title:
join(): iterable
'*'.join(iterable)
len:獲取字串字元的數量,長度。
python 字串常用操作
coding utf 8 str1 dafhgfshhk lfhgj hhs dhfs len str1 計算長度,當有中文時需要顯示轉換為utf 8編碼,否則計算的結果會有誤差 str2 中文 len str2 結果是 6 將字串顯示轉換為utf 8 str3 str2.decode utf 8 ...
python 字串常用操作
name my name is yy print name.capitalize 首字母大寫 print name.count y 統計y的個數 print name.center 50,以name內容沒中心,不夠的用 代替 print name.endswith yy 以yy結尾 布林值 name...
python 字串常用操作
name monicao name.capitalize 首字母大寫 print name.capitalize print name.count o 統計某個字元的個數 name1 my name is monica print name1.center 50,返回字串寬度 即長度 為50的字串,...